I'm encountering this issue when attempting to fly a STAR approach which has been selected in the MSFS flight planner (i.e. Departure > SID > Enroute > STAR > Destination auto-populated by the sim).
https://github.com/flybywiresim/a32nx/discussions/3494
The aircraft (tested with a few different types) has navigation hold mode engaged with NAV/GPS set to GPS. The autopilot correctly tracks the SID and enroute phases but as per the topic above, tracks directly to the destination upon reaching the last waypoint in the STAR, rather than transitioning to the selected approach. The magenta line on the nav map turns into a dashed line.
The only solution that I've found so far is to manually direct-to the first approach waypoint using something like the PMS50 GTN 750.
